Job Description

Overview Under the direction of the appropriate laboratory management and/or the clinical director performs and develops testing for the clinical laboratory. Ensures that efficient and effective work process use and procedures are followed utilizing regulatory and safety requirements. Performs patient testing as requested by the administrative or assistant director. Serves as a technical resource for the department. Key Responsibilities Evaluates new tests and develops projects according to plans and guidelines provided by the clinical director and/or laboratory supervisor. Coordinates and oversees development projects such as new assays and procedures in the department. Communicates scientific information and progress to the laboratory supervisor and director. Under the direction and consultation with the appropriate laboratory management delegates responsibilities on development projects to appropriate technologists. Provides technical advice and direction and serves as the resource person for laboratory staff involved in a development project. Troubleshoots problems with laboratory instruments and procedures and makes necessary corrections. Performs feasibility studies and cost-benefit analyses on new initiatives. Continuously evaluates current instrumentation and procedures to identify quality and efficiency improvements for laboratory methods technology and instruments. Responds to inquiries about assays results clinical protocols reference ranges and laboratory procedures. Assists in writing new procedures and helps to ensure all policies and procedures are up to date.  Performs testing responsibilities of medical laboratory technologists when the need arises or during periods of a significant staffing shortage. Qualifications : Minimum Qualifications Education:  Bachelors Degree in Medical Technology Basic Sciences or another related field is required.  ASCP certification or equivalent preferred. Experience:  Three years of relevant experience is required.
